MP983 Switch Settings
Use this information at your own risk!
We do not believe that any modifications should be taken lightly and while we believe that this information is accurate, it is provided on a use at your own risk basis. Plus reflashing of a BIOS can lead to a dead laptop.
Static electricity does damage electronic components and good anti-static procedures must be used at any time that a laptop is undergoing repair or update.
Always firmly close the CPU socket after replacing a CPU by pushing the socket closed until there's no gap ( I mean zero!) on the open side!
Motherboard Dip Switch Settings
The motherboard revision number is silk screened on the motherboard under the right side memory module. This revison may also be determined by the third digit from the left in the Chicony bar code serial number that's glued to the motherboard. (This is not the laptop brand's S/N)However, this second method can be misleading to someone has switched S/N's.

Settings for Motherboards 001-983-
Rev. "A", "C", "D" (?) and "E"xx only
Note that a Rev. "A" is not interchangeable with other revision motherboard other than the above Rev. "B" due to the size of the video adaptor connector.
Note: Based upon the only example of MP983 motherboard Rev C that I have seen, the Rev. C motherboard does not support any AMD CPU. I this it true then the Rev C is limited to using an Intel 233mmx or slower CPU.

Settings for Motherboard 001-983-Fxx
Same Sw1 settings as Rev A, C, D and E
However the core voltage setting chart is as below
These motherboards will still have the voltage chart located in the hard drive area. There may also be a second label stating that a 266 MHz CPU is okay to install (1.9 V for Intel laptop 266mmx CPU) in which case there will be a tiny switch on the top side of the motherboard near the back edge of the hole for the CPU. This switch needs to be switched for a 1.9 V CPU. Do not mess with this switch for any other reason. Plus you must then set the rotary core voltage switch to 3.3V, I believe.
